People who are dependent on drugs or alcohol may not reach out for the help they need, before it is too late. Family members frequently have to intervene to obtain them help, and it is important that anyone seeking effective drug and alcohol rehab understand what kinds of drug rehab in Pelham, AL. are available and which ones will prove most beneficial. Don't assume all drug rehab in Pelham, Alabama is identical, for example there are short-term drug and alcohol treatment programs and long-term facilities, in addition to outpatient and inpatient facilities. There's also residential centers, and this type of drug rehab in Pelham is an ideal environment for individuals who select a long-term rehabilitation option, because they'll be in drug rehab in Pelham, AL. for some time and these kinds of centers offer a lot of the comforts and amenities of home.

Many people looking for drug rehab in Pelham, Alabama or their loved ones who are searching for a rehab option lean towards programs and treatment centers which will return the addicted individual home and also to their normal everyday lives as quickly as possible. Obviously anybody that is in drug treatment really wants to make it through the process and get return to their obligations, families, etc. at the earliest opportunity. This is why outpatient and short-term drug rehab in Pelham seems like the most ideal treatment option for addicted individuals as well as their families. Quite often however, individuals develop a deep physical and even psychological dependency to drugs and alcohol which makes these seemingly convenient drug rehab in Pelham, AL. options inviable.

While at first in any sort of drug rehab in Pelham, Alabama, those who are just recently abstaining from drugs and alcohol are detoxed and ideally assisted through this, with withdrawal made a bit easier with the assistance of detox experts. Even though someone is detoxed however, they are still going to encounter intense cravings to drink or use drugs, cravings which might persist for quite a while. Some people claim to experience such cravings for the remainder of their lives, but ideally cope through them with the life tools and workable coping methods they acquire in an effective Pelham drug rehab. Let's say someone is in an outpatient drug rehab in Pelham, AL. while still encountering these extreme cravings, and go back home every day whilst in rehab. Studies indicate that drug abuse is often times triggered by environmental elements, like life stressors, or perhaps people their environment who may trigger it. This may be an abusive relationship, somebody that promotes and participates in the person's habit or another situation which may prompt the individual to turn to drugs or alcohol as a social aid, as an escape or to self medicate. This will make an outpatient situation the least optimum, since the whole reason for drug rehab in Pelham, Alabama is always to resolve many of these situations while there. This is why relapses are extremely common with outpatient drug rehab.

Also, short-term drug rehab in Pelham which provides treatment for 30 days or less are really the least ideal treatment settings even if receiving inpatient or residential rehabilitation. As stated earlier, individuals who have recently abstained from alcohol and drugs need quite a bit of time to recover physically and really stabilize from the dependence a result of their drug use. After just a couple weeks, individuals in drug rehab in Pelham, AL. are just becoming accustomed to a drug free lifestyle, and finding out how to adjust physically, mentally, and emotionally without their drug of choice. This leaves very little time to enable them to clearly focus on what can actually help them to have a drug free and healthy way of life once they return home, which may take quite a while for individuals who might need to make considerable and life changing decisions and change in lifestyle.

Long-term drug rehab in Pelham, Alabama is a perfect rehab option for various reasons, but above all it offers the required change of environment and also the intensity of rehabilitation needed for many who desire to reap all the benefits of rehabilitation and also sustain these gains once they go back home to their normal lives. Long-term drug rehab in Pelham is available in either an inpatient or residential treatment facility, with the main differences being inpatient offers treatment services for many who make require hospital services as part of their rehab process. This could be true for a person that's experiencing a physical ailment or life-threatening disease which may have been worsened due to their drug abuse, or somebody who may require help being weaned from medical drugs that they have become dependent to.

With regards to long-term residential drug rehab in Pelham, AL., these facilities offer many of the comforts of home so the individual can feel relaxed throughout the often lengthy drug and alcohol treatment process. Even though it is difficult to be away from family members whilst in treatment for several months, this kind of center helps it be much easier to endure through the process. And after all, the sacrifice makes it worth it in the end when the individual can go back home ready to live a happy, productive and drug free lifestyle.
